Chelseaās season is officially going from bad to worse at Brighton.
The hosts took a quickfire lead asĀ Ferdi KadıoÄlu converted aĀ Pascal GroĆ to pile on the misery to Liam Roseniorās side which also exposed another worrying flaw.

It was the earliest time that the Blues have shipped a Premier League goal directly since December 2003, when Roman Abramovichās ownership was in its infancy.
If that didnāt make grim enough reading, they have also equalled a club record for the mostĀ goals conceded from corners in a top-flight campaign, which stood for 31 years.
Worse still, BBC Sport claim Chelsea have now conceded eight goalsĀ in the first 15 minutes of games this season ā a feat only beaten by two relegation candidates.
That Champions League qualification spot feels like itās ebbing away game by game.
